How Solar-Powered Smart Devices Work

Photovoltaics meet low-power computing

Modern solar-powered smart devices pair compact photovoltaic cells with ultra-efficient microcontrollers and sensors. By prioritizing sleep modes and event-based wakeups, they use only the energy captured from ambient light. Share your favorite low-power gadgets and help others discover what works in real homes.

Batteries, supercapacitors, and smart power budgets

Energy storage matters. Lithium iron phosphate cells, nickel-metal hydride packs, or supercapacitors buffer cloudy days and nighttime. Everyday Uses That Make Life Brighter

Reliable solar lights combine efficient LEDs, motion detection, and dusk-to-dawn logic. They illuminate steps, sheds, and alleys without pulling grid power. Everyday Uses That Make Life Brighter

A solar smart irrigation controller can monitor soil moisture, track evapotranspiration, and adjust watering schedules after cloudy streaks. Pair with rain sensors to avoid waste. Sustainability, Costs, and Real Impact

Choose repairable designs with replaceable batteries and standard cells. Prefer panels and enclosures that list recyclability and RoHS compliance. Plan for take-back programs.
